During the 2026 Grammy Awards, host Trevor Noah delivered a monologue that included jokes about Nicki Minaj and President Trump, eliciting a strong reaction from the president. Noah's comments about Minaj's recent visit to the White House and a joke about Trump wanting Greenland drew particular attention. President Trump responded on Truth Social, denying Noah's claims and threatening legal action. This marks Noah's sixth and final time hosting the Grammys, where he balanced humor with pointed commentary.
